Output d3246f260abc5565e20824251775cb4125124ccb41ecd97a4c3594deafc78907:0

value
34851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e0696c5b7242265e8d5a36c1eb042e62bd92d93 OP_EQUAL
address
3DBNxXHWEkxyTkA3sX7wFVdb6uZ3LiHv4d
transaction
d3246f260abc5565e20824251775cb4125124ccb41ecd97a4c3594deafc78907